Output 8fa1b31053d20d98597ba161201e3af04649c41078603b8101d7b78f49aecf7b:0

value
691078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d361c77926659f7e856b61c3279b68ae100f8cb2 OP_EQUAL
address
3LxhdqX8kwQuQduvsnnuinU4KHKgziVcMh
transaction
8fa1b31053d20d98597ba161201e3af04649c41078603b8101d7b78f49aecf7b
spent
true